RAIC Long Term Care Working Group Presents: Redefining Long-Term Care: Architecture, Culture, and Person-Centered Approaches

Join us for a 90-minute moderated panel discussion exploring the evolving role of architecture in long-term care (LTC) and dementia-friendly environments. In this session, experts will address key issues such as redefining institutional care, fostering cultural change, and creating architectural solutions that prioritize person-centered care. Panelists will share their experiences with new models of care, the importance of individualized care plans, and the impact of inclusive design on quality of life for residents.

Built Environment: An Alternative Guide to Japan
 
Athabasca University's RAIC Centre for Architecture is currently hosting an exhibition on Japanese architecture in collaboration with the University of Calgary and the Consulate-General of Japan in Calgary. The Japan Foundation traveling exhibition features 80 examples of buildings, civil engineering works and landscapes, etc., from all the prefectures of Japan, which are introduced through photographs, text and video images. It presents a rarely considered aspect of Japan, taking the built environment of the various regions of a country that is geographically diverse and often struck by natural disasters, with the aim of examining how Japanese people have engaged and struggled with the natural environment and how they have carried on and created locality.

UIA Daylight Award
 
The Daylight Award, the biennial prize honouring outstanding contributions to daylight research and daylight in architecture, is now open for nominations for its 2026 edition. Every second year, The Daylight Award honours both a researcher and an architect whose work advances the understanding and application of daylight. Nominations for 2026 are open from 16 May 2025, UNESCO International Day of Light, until 15 September 2025.
